An easy service that can be accessed by our customers to gain information on any vessel that they wish to track.
How does it work?
Select the Port and Terminal code
Further filtration can be done by entering information such as Rotation, Vessel Name, Arrived From, Sail To, etc.
Select the desired radio button that information you are looking for.
Along with the general information of vessel, this service also provides information such as Call Reason, E.T.A, Berth, E.T.D and Cut-off date.
